Stocks in news today

March 10, 2023

Adani Enterprises: Company’s promoter has created a pledge of 0.76% and 0.99% pledge of Adani transmission and Adani green energy respectively. Pledge has been created in favour of SBICAP trustee. Pledge was made on March 6th.

State Bank of India: Bank has raised Rs 3,717 crore through additional tier-1 bond issuance. The proceeds of this will be utilised in augmenting additional tier-1 capital, overall capital base of the bank and strengthen capital adequacy

Shriram Finance: Smallcap World Fund Inc. acquired the company’s shares worth 2.03 million in a block deal on Wednesday. New World Fund Inc. also acquired 5.07 million shares.

Bharat Forge: Company has announced an e-bike manufacturing facility at MIDC Chakan. The manufacturing will be done through its wholly-owned subsidiary Kalyani Powertrain.

Jindal Stainless: iShares Core MSCI Emerging Markets ETF has bought 33.69 lakh equity shares amounting to 0.64% stake in the company through open market transactions, at an average price of Rs 309.42 per share. The shares are worth Rs 104.3 crore.

Shoppers Stop: Shiseido Asia Pacific Pte Ltd has signed a strategic distribution partnership agreement with Global SS Beauty Brands, a subsidiary of Shoppers Stop, to expand its brand footprint in India.

Sovereign Gold Bonds: Series 4 Sovereign gold bond opened for subscription on 6th March, with an annual interest payment of 3.50%. Per unit cost of the bond is Rs 5,561. 10th March is the last date to apply for the issue.
